【docker】——【Compose】——【新增项目】,输入项目名称:mariadb,路径选择:/vol1/1000/Docker/mariadb。 来源选择【创建docker-compose.yaml】,复制下面的yaml文件代码粘贴,勾选【创建项目后立即启动】,最后点击【完成】。 mariadb+ phpmyadmin.yaml代码如下: version: '3.8' # 指定 Docker Compose 文件的版本,...
yum install docker-ce docker-ce-cli containerd.io ###安裝MariaDB###(mariadb_root_password 是指定Docker啟動後,這個MariaDB root帳號的密碼) docker run -d -e 'MYSQL_ROOT_PASSWORD=mariadb_root_password' -e 'TZ=Asia/Taipei' -v '/home/myusername/database/mariadb':'/var/lib/mysql' -v '...
docker pull $(docker search phpmyadmin|awk'NR==2{print}'|awk'{print $2}') 然后执行运行的MySQL的镜像的命令,一定要输入提示的内容 echo请输入数据库端口&&readdp&&echo请输入数据库密码&&readdbpass&&docker run -d -p$dp:3306 -e MYSQL_ROOT_PASSWORD=$dbpass$(docker images|grep mariadb|awk'{pri...
安装Docker 可视化容器管理工具 – Portainer 安装教程 创建用于持久化存储 mariadb 数据的目录(命名规则参考) mkdir-p'自定义数据目录'/mariadb/data# 数据库数据目录mkdir-p'自定义数据目录'/mariadb/etc# 数据库配置目录 Copy 登录Portainer 管理页面选择local 点击左侧Stacks,在该页面中点击Add stack 为Stack命名...
如果要使用 MariaDB ,要怎么操作呢?还记得前面说到的 TCP/IP 和 Socket 吗?要使用 TCP/IP 方式进行连接,就必须要在 MariaDB 界面中勾选启用。 在使用 Docker Compose 文件的复杂项目中,往往也会拉取数据库镜像,我们可以通过修改其配置文件来达到共用数据库服务的目的。不过这个操作更加复杂,由于文章篇幅限制,我...
我正在尝试设置一个基本的 LAMP 堆栈,但在容器运行时docker-compose无法使用它连接到mariadb数据库。phpmyadmin为了尝试解决该问题,我将docker-compose.yaml文件剥离为:version: '3.2' services: db: image: mariadb container_name: appsDB restart: always ports: - '6603:3306' environment: MYSQL_ROOT_PASSWORD:...
问phpmyadmin无法用docker-组合连接到mariadb :数据包无法正常运行EN在用docker安装 ElasticSearch 时,能...
还记得前面说到的 TCP/IP 和 Socket 吗?要使用 TCP/IP 方式进行连接,就必须要在 MariaDB 界面中勾选启用。 在使用 Docker Compose 文件的复杂项目中,往往也会拉取数据库镜像,我们可以通过修改其配置文件来达到共用数据库服务的目的。不过这个操作更加复杂,由于文章篇幅限制,我们后面再说。
首先启动MariaDB的容器 在上一节中我们知道数据库的用户名是root,密码是123456,但是我们还缺少数据库的ip地址,我们使用如下方法获取docker实例的ip地址,是172.17.0.3 [root@test01 ~]# docker ps C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ES
原来我有白群晖的,后来… Henry 群晖系统上的 Docker 使用拾遗 苏洋 群晖NAS-6.1搭建 Web网站 1.首先要安装下面的三个套件: 编辑 搜图 2.开启Web服务: 编辑 搜图 编辑 搜图 3.设置Http群组对Web文件夹的读写权限: 编辑 搜图 4.设置数据库密码: 编辑 搜图 或者是MariaDB10的数据库… 风花雪月...